Position Overview

The Instrumentation and Electrical Engineer will provide technical leadership and engineering expertise supporting upstream unconventional oil & gas facilities. This role will be responsible for instrumentation & controls and electrical systems across design, construction, commissioning, and operational support, ensuring compliance with applicable codes, standards, and project objectives.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ead and support Instrumentation & Controls (I&C) and Electrical engineering activities for upstream oil & gas facilities.
  • Provide technical oversight for I&E design engineering, construction, and commissioning efforts.
  • Support automation and control system design, implementation, and troubleshooting.
  • Ensure compliance with NEC code requirements and ISA standards.
  • Interface with project management, construction, commissioning, and operations teams to ensure project alignment.
  • Support project execution through scope development, technical reviews, and issue resolution.
  • Participate in project planning, execution, and closeout activities.
  • Provide technical input and oversight for contractor engineering deliverables.
  • Support safe, reliable, and efficient facility operation through sound engineering practices.
